]> git.ipfire.org Git - people/ms/libloc.git/blob - src/libloc.sym
network: Fix walking through the tree in order
[people/ms/libloc.git] / src / libloc.sym
1 LIBLOC_PRIVATE {
2 global:
3 # AS
4 loc_as_cmp;
5 loc_as_get_name;
6 loc_as_get_number;
7 loc_as_new;
8 loc_as_ref;
9 loc_as_set_name;
10 loc_as_unref;
11
12 # Database
13 loc_database_add_as;
14 loc_database_count_as;
15 loc_database_created_at;
16 loc_database_get_as;
17 loc_database_get_description;
18 loc_database_get_vendor;
19 loc_database_new;
20 loc_database_ref;
21 loc_database_unref;
22
23 # Network
24 loc_network_get_asn;
25 loc_network_get_country_code;
26 loc_network_new;
27 loc_network_new_from_string;
28 loc_network_set_asn;
29 loc_network_set_country_code;
30 loc_network_str;
31 loc_network_unref;
32
33 # Network Tree
34 loc_network_tree_add_network;
35 loc_network_tree_count_networks;
36 loc_network_tree_count_nodes;
37 loc_network_tree_dump;
38 loc_network_tree_new;
39 loc_network_tree_unref;
40
41 # String Pool
42 loc_stringpool_add;
43 loc_stringpool_dump;
44 loc_stringpool_get;
45 loc_stringpool_get_size;
46 loc_stringpool_new;
47 loc_stringpool_ref;
48 loc_stringpool_unref;
49
50 # Writer
51 loc_writer_add_as;
52 loc_writer_add_network;
53 loc_writer_get_description;
54 loc_writer_get_vendor;
55 loc_writer_new;
56 loc_writer_ref;
57 loc_writer_set_description;
58 loc_writer_set_vendor;
59 loc_writer_unref;
60 loc_writer_write;
61 };
62
63 LIBLOC_1 {
64 global:
65 loc_ref;
66 loc_get_log_priority;
67 loc_set_log_fn;
68 loc_unref;
69 loc_set_log_priority;
70 loc_new;
71 loc_load;
72 local:
73 *;
74 };